James Bond (Protagonist)

Appears from the start

A British Secret Service officer operating under cover at the casino in Royale-les-Eaux. Experienced, controlled, and attentive to risk, he closely watches the play and the people around him before committing himself at the tables.

Mr Du Pont (Minor)

Appears from the start

A wealthy acquaintance whom Bond encounters at the Royale-les-Eaux casino. His losses to Le Chiffre help establish the opponent's formidable reputation at baccarat.

Le Chiffre (Antagonist)

First appears in chapter 2

The treasurer of a Soviet-controlled trade union in France and an accomplished gambler. After losing his organisation's funds in a failed investment, he seeks to recover the money at baccarat before his Soviet superiors discover the loss.

M (Supporting)

First appears in chapter 3

The head of the British Secret Service and Bond's superior. He approves an unusual gambling operation intended to bankrupt Le Chiffre and damage Soviet influence in France.

René Mathis (Supporting)

First appears in chapter 4

A French intelligence officer assigned as Bond's local contact at Royale-les-Eaux. Sociable and observant, he supplies practical support while respecting Bond's need to preserve his cover.

Vesper Lynd (Supporting)

First appears in chapter 5

An assistant from the British service's headquarters sent to pose as Bond's companion. She is capable and reserved, and her arrival complicates Bond's preference for conducting dangerous work alone.

Leo (Minor)

First appears in chapter 6

One of two gunmen employed by Le Chiffre. He takes part in an attempted bombing meant to remove Bond before the decisive gambling session.

Felix Leiter (Supporting)

First appears in chapter 8

An American intelligence officer working in Europe who befriends Bond during the casino operation. He watches the baccarat game and is prepared to give discreet assistance when the British stake is threatened.

Adolph Gettler (Minor)

First appears in chapter 25

A man with an eye patch who appears at the seaside resort during Bond and Vesper's convalescence. His presence intensifies Vesper's fear that they are being watched.
